Overview

Numeracy leader and intervention teacher role at Melbourne Archdiocese Catholic Schools. The role is a combined, full-time position with a split allocation: 3.5 days (FTE 0.70) as numeracy intervention teacher and 1.5 days (FTE 0.30) as numeracy leader. The successful applicant should be committed to delivering a high standard of teaching and to contributing to a vibrant, professional team where student learning and wellbeing define our work.

Experience in the role of Numeracy leader is preferred. A passion and enthusiasm for leading learning and a collaborative, team-based approach to teaching are essential. Teaching and learning at our school are contemporary, with collaboration and ongoing professional growth valued to create an effective learning environment for students. Knowledge and experience with the Victorian Curriculum and the ability to develop programs to meet diverse student needs are expected.

Responsibilities
  • Have an understanding, commitment, and support for the values and ethos of the Catholic school and the mission of the Catholic Church
  • Demonstrate a commitment to the safety and wellbeing of children in accordance with Child Safe standards
  • Foster and develop professional relationships with students, staff, parents, and the wider school community
  • Collaboratively plan and work in a team with flexibility, creativity, passion and enthusiasm
  • View themselves as a lifelong learner and foster that mindset in all students
  • Display initiative and commitment to ongoing improvement
  • Have knowledge of contemporary learning with emphasis on the MACS Vision for Instruction, explicit teaching strategies, and cognitive load theory
  • Have sound knowledge on mental strategies, mathematics concepts, and place value
  • Gather, analyse, and use data (formal and informal) to improve teaching practice, pedagogy, and student outcomes (e.g., PAT-M, NAPLAN)
  • Commit to ongoing professional knowledge and skills in teaching, learning, and student wellbeing
  • Incorporate the Digital Technologies curriculum to engage students
  • Work with children at risk in small groups using targeted programs to improve outcomes
  • Be adaptable and have a sense of humour
  • Hold full VIT registration
  • Be accredited to teach Religious Education in a Catholic school
